3D Bubble Letters Mastery
1. Lighting Fundamentals
- Single Light Source: Keep highlights top-left unless matching a specific mockup.
- Depth Slider: 20–35 works for print; >40 can look cartoonish online.
- Shadow Color: Use a darker shade of the fill color (not pure black) for realism.
2. Workflow
- Start with Flat Fill preset to nail proportions.
- Enable 3D depth and adjust bevel softness to avoid jagged edges.
- Add ambient occlusion for grounded shadows.
- Export PNG + SVG; drop SVG into Figma or Blender for motion.

4. Export Checklist
- PNG with transparent BG at 2400 px wide.
- SVG for vector editing.
- PDF for print-ready signage.
